Modeling
The process of observing and imitating a specific behavior exhibited by others.
Parasuicide
A term used to describe a suicide attempt or self-harming behavior that does not result in death, often seen as a cry for help or a way to cope with distressing feelings.
Schizophrenia
A psychotic disorder in which personal, social, and occupational functioning deteriorate as a result of strange perceptions, disturbed thought processes, unusual emotions, and motor abnormalities.
Voices
A common term for auditory hallucinations, particularly in the context of some psychiatric disorders, where individuals hear sounds or voices without external stimuli.
